What is a printed circuit board in PCB Design - Why It Matters
Imagine trying to connect hundreds of tiny electronic parts by hand using wires, making sure each connection is perfect and nothing touches by mistake.
This manual wiring is slow, messy, and full of errors. It's hard to fix mistakes, and the final product is bulky and unreliable.
A printed circuit board (PCB) solves this by providing a neat, flat board with printed pathways that connect parts automatically and precisely.

PCBs make building complex electronics fast, reliable, and compact, enabling all modern devices we use daily.
Every smartphone has a PCB inside that connects the battery, screen, camera, and processor seamlessly.
